Zurich North America held a ribbon-cutting ceremony Wednesday to open its new headquarters building in Schaumburg, Illinois.

Many of the 3,000 employees and contractors who will work in the building contributed to the crowdsourcing of ideas regarding workspace features, the company said.

Several of the design suggestions — especially those enhancing communication, collaboration and wellness — are being replicated in other Zurich offices around the United States, according to the company

Zurich North America's new headquarters building is 11-stories tall, contains 783,800 square feet of space and sits on a 40-acre site, which includes 2,774 parking spaces.

Focus on sustainability

"This building is a showcase of all we are at Zurich: its excellence in design, its focus on sustainability, and its reflection of our employees," said Mike Foley, chief executive officer for Zurich North America.

The headquarters building has received the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design Platinum certification from the U.S. Green Building Council for its multiple green roofs, rainwater harvesting, accommodations for electric vehicles and energy efficient technologies, along with a landscape that includes native plants and more than 600 trees.

Home in Illinois for over 100 years

"Zurich has called Illinois home for more than 100 years," said Dennis Kerrigan, chief legal officer and executive sponsor of the new headquarters project. "We value our continued relationship with the community as an employer and contributor to the regional economy. We know many of our employees live in the northwest suburbs of Chicago, and it was important to us to maintain and grow our staff and continue to be a great place to work."

Four Zurich North America employees — John Keohane, Peggy Alario, Kathy Moran and Lud Picarro — who died in the Sept. 11, 2001, terrorist attacks are remembered in a garden in their honor on the grounds, the company said.
